The Union of Independent Trade Unions of Kosovo (BSPK) has invited its member unions, public- and private-sector employees, and their families to join the “March for Freedom.” The event will be held tomorrow, September 12, starting at 14:00, in Skanderbeg Square in Pristina.

In a statement to the media, BSPK explained that the march does not have a contemporary political character, but is connected to historical memory and the preservation of social dignity.
The union considers the Kosovo Liberation Army’s (KLA) war to have been inseparable from the resistance of workers, miners, teachers, students, and Kosovo families during the period of repression.
“Within this historical narrative, the Student Movement of October 1, 1997, holds particular importance. That day, students of the University of Pristina protested peacefully for their right to education, but were met with violence by the Serbian police. Several months later, many of them joined the KLA, while some never returned to the lecture halls. For this reason, the student, the worker, and the fighter are part of the same continuum of resistance for freedom,” the statement said.
BSPK announced that it supports the rule of law and the right to a fair and impartial trial. However, it stressed that justice must be based solely on evidence and individual responsibility, without changing the liberating character of the KLA’s war.
The organization asked the unions and regional offices to contribute to coordinating participation, while appealing for the march to be conducted calmly, orderly, and with dignity.
“Kosovo’s workers will be present in the square not as representatives of any political side, but as part of a people that did not win its freedom as a gift,” BSPK said in its statement.
